籼型杂交水稻恢复系种子休眠特性研究

Seed dormancy characteristics of restorer lines of indica hybrid rice

【摘要】 为了解籼型杂交水稻种子的休眠特性,以3个杂交水稻恢复系纯系为研究材料,于2007~2009年早、晚季种植,种子收获后按一定时间进行发芽试验。结果表明,同一年份同一收获季节,不同材料种子的休眠特性不同;相同材料同一年份,不同收获季节水稻恢复系种子的休眠期长短不同,休眠性强的材料早、晚季休眠期差别较大,休眠性弱的材料早、晚季休眠期差别较小,一般相同材料晚季休眠期比早季长;相同材料同一收获季节,种子休眠性在年度间也存在一定差异。

【Abstract】 The present experiment has been conducted to identify the seed dormancy characteristics in the restorer lines of indica hybrid rice.Seed germination tests were carried out after harvest,using three hybrid rice(planted in early and late cropping during 2007-2009) pure restorer lines as experimental materials.The results showed differed seed dormancy amongst different rice materials harvested during the same season.The same pure lines harvested in different seasons in a year also had different dormancy period.And rice restorer seeds harvested at different seasons had different dormancy periods.The materials with strong dormancy had different dormancy period when planted as early and late crops,while it was not significant on the materials with weak dormancy.In general,the dormancy period of the same material which was harvested in late season was longer than that harvested in early season.And the seed dormancy of the same material harvested in the same season between different years had certain difference.
